To guarantee self-renewal, stem cells bear two forms of cell division (see Stem cell division and differentiation diagram). Symmetric division presents increase to 2 similar daughter cells each endowed with stem cell Houses. Asymmetric division, However, generates only one stem cell as well as a progenitor cell with minimal self-renewal potential.

50 Twine blood derived CD34+ cells have quite powerful hematopoietic skills, and this is attributed to the immaturity of your stem cells relative to Grownup derived cells. Scientific studies are already done that analyze long-term survival of kids with hematologic Issues who were transplanted with umbilical cord blood from the sibling donor. These studied exposed the same or better survival in the kids that received the umbilical cord blood relative to the ones that obtained transplantation from bone marrow cells. Moreover, rates of relapse were precisely the same for both equally umbilical wire blood and bone marrow transplant.51
